The sun will be shining high over Queens Gardens this Saturday for the annual Summer exhibition in the Queens Garden.
Now into it's 51st year, 44 artists will be exhibiting art work from a variety of mediums from oil, acrylic, watercolour, collage, mixed media, photography to pottery and resin art.
Along with an opportunity to meet and talk with the artists, limited edition prints, pottery bowls and mugs, framed art work of all shapes and sizes and cards will be for sale at affordable prices.
Event organiser Gilly Booth says 'The artists are from all walks of life some are professional artists and others amateurs creating art just for the love of it, no judgement'.
Art Group Nelson meets once a month at Greenmeadows on Songer Street, Stoke with speakers and demonstrations. Members can show their art and get feedback if they wish from the wealth of experience in the group, while enjoying the social environment. The main aim of the group is the fostering and encouraging of artists at all levels.
'We also hold instructional workshops throughout the year with discounted prices for members. In Winter/Spring there is an Exhibition at Greenmeadows with an opportunity for artists to win awards and prizes.
This year we are greatful for the support of MenzShed who have built new frames for displaying of artwork.' says Gilly.
